python - python中的haralyzer库
问题描述
我正在尝试将我的这部分代码与 for 循环一起使用,但我收到此错误,我不明白为什么没有循环它可以正常工作。
sites=['altervista.org', 'amazon.it', 'ansa.it']
for num in range(0,3):
y=sites[num]+'.har'
with open(y, 'r') as f:
har_parser = HarParser(json.loads(f.read()))
data= har_parser.har_data
我收到此错误:\
---------------------------------------------------------------------------
AttributeError Traceback (most recent call last)
<ipython-input-3-c5779b6aa6f7> in <module>
2 y=sites[num]+'.har'
3 with open(y, 'r') as f:
----> 4 har_parser = HarParser(json.loads(f.read()))
5 data= har_parser.har_data
6 url=[]
AttributeError: 'int' object has no attribute 'loads'
问题是什么???
解决方案
推荐阅读
- r - 参数不是数字或逻辑函数 rollapply,后跟强制引入的 NA
- javascript - HTML/JS 引用 ID
- c++ - c++中控制台上的winmouse坐标
- javascript - 在 setInterval 时间使用 JSON 变量
- c# - Asp.Net:无法读取文件名并发布到 AWS S3
- python - 使用 iterrows 更改行下的所有值
- r - 使用数据框中的应用函数对基因进行 T 检验
- vb.net - 有没有更有效的方法来编写这段代码?
- javascript - CSS - 如何在 ReactJS 中悬停作为另一个组件的父级时制作光标:指针?
- python - Google Colab files.download() 稳定性